Fred Wilson asks a timely question today, in the wake of Hillary Clinton officially throwing her hat in the 2008 ring:
"A Return To Royalty?
It's not that I am against Hillary. I think she's smart and I generally agree with her politics.
But if she's elected President, the past four presidents will be from two families, the Bushes and the Clintons.
What does that say about our country and our democracy?"
Let's of course not forget the Kennedys not so very long ago.
It made me think of how I used to be so critical of my former country, India, for so many years.
For despite it's claim to be the "world's largest democracy", it's national politics have been marked by family dynasties like Nehru-Gandhi holding sway for decades.
It's a good question, Fred.
Are we emulating so many younger, developing democracies around the world?
Or hasn't it always been this way, in political systems young or old?
